2. Is digital signature legal?
Yes, it is completely legal. After ESIGN Act concluded in 2000, an electronic signature is considered as a legal tool. You can complete a writable document and sign it, and to official institutions it will be the same as if you signed a hard copy with pen, old-fashioned.
